    Here's the thing ... most people will quit. Especially now. Most people are freaking out, getting day jobs, slowing down marketing, cutting down on advertising, cutting their prices, etc.

    Let's live in opposite land. Create a more narrow niche, specialize, and raise your prices. Buy more advertising. Launch a new product. Go for big funding.

    Part of success (especially right now) is just to be the last person in the room after everyone else chickens out. :)
